• 设为首页
  • 点击收藏
  • 手机版
    手机扫一扫访问
    迪恩网络手机版
  • 关注官方公众号
    微信扫一扫关注
    公众号

Swift 教程

RSS
  • 【纯代码】Swift-自定义底部弹窗基类(可根据需要自行扩展内容) ...
    【纯代码】Swift-自定义底部弹窗基类(可根据需要自行扩展内容) ...
    //弹窗视图classPopView:UIView{varselectButtonCallBack:((_title:String)-amp;amp;gt;Void)?varcontenView:UIView?{didSet{setUpContent()}}ove……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:08 | 阅读:50 | 回复:0
  • IOSUIWebView与js的简单交互swift3版
    IOSUIWebView与js的简单交互swift3版
    在开发过程中,我们可能遇到ios代码与js交互的情况,本人第一次使用遇到了很多坑,这里纪录一下,方便自己,也方便需要的人。p.p1{margin:0;font:12pxMenlo;color:rgba(231,232,236,1)}p.p2{margin:0;font:12pxMenlo; 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:08 | 阅读:49 | 回复:0
  • swiftAlamofire请求数据与SwiftJson解析
    swiftAlamofire请求数据与SwiftJson解析
    一直在研究swift 程序最重要的是什么???答案当然是数据啦。 数据对一个程序的影响有多大自己想去吧!!!如果你非要说不重要,那你现在就可以关网页了 哈哈哈哈哈 我呢 swift新手 菜鸟一个 大家都知道在oc 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:08 | 阅读:48 | 回复:0
  • Swift-编程一小时
    Swift-编程一小时
    准备 基础知识 编程(programming)就是告诉计算机要做什么。计算机只是一些没有 生命的机器,它们自己可不知道该做什么,一切都得你来告诉它,而且你还必须把 细节都说清楚。不过,一旦给计算机“下达”了正确的指 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:07 | 阅读:118 | 回复:0
  • 如何用Parse和Swift搭建一个像Instagram那样的应用?
    如何用Parse和Swift搭建一个像Instagram那样的应用?
    【编者按】本篇文章作者是ReinderdeVries,既是一名企业家,也是优秀的程序员,发表多篇应用程序的博客。本篇文章中,作者主要介绍了如何基于Parse特点,打造一款类似Instagram的应用,完整而清晰的步骤,为开发者提 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:07 | 阅读:79 | 回复:0
  • Swift--struct与class的区别(汇编角度底层分析)
    Swift--struct与class的区别(汇编角度底层分析)
    概述 ** https://m.xs86.com 相对Objective-C, Swift使用结构体Struct的比例大大增加了,其中Int, Bool,以及String,Array等底层全部使用Struct来定义!在Swift中结构体不仅可以定义成员变量(属性),还可以定义成员方法, 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:07 | 阅读:81 | 回复:0
  • swift学习初步(三)--控制流操作
    swift学习初步(三)--控制流操作
      在上一篇博客里面,我谈到了swift里面的一些基本类型以及相关的操作,相信你看了之后一定会觉得其实swift也不难嘛。好吧,这篇博客里面要谈的一些高级操作,可能会让你有点头疼了。  好了,废话不多说了,让我 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:07 | 阅读:81 | 回复:0
  • [Swift]LeetCode506.相对名次|RelativeRanks
    [Swift]LeetCode506.相对名次|RelativeRanks
    ★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★➤微信公众号:山青咏芝(shanqingyongzhi)➤博客园地址:山青咏芝(https://www.cnblogs.com/strengthen/)➤GitHub地址:http 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:07 | 阅读:86 | 回复:0
  • swift解决tableView的Y值偏移64问题
    swift解决tableView的Y值偏移64问题
        //起始坐标按0点开始计算self.edgesForExtendedLayout=UIRectEdge.init(rawValue:0) //tableView的坐标系tableView.snp.makeConstraints{(make)in      make.top.equalTo(view.snp.top)       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:07 | 阅读:60 | 回复:0
  • Facebook 针对 iOS 推出 Swift 开发者工具包
    Facebook 针对 iOS 推出 Swift 开发者工具包
    Swift3中文网消息,Facebook为iOS开发者推出了Swift开发者工具包(SDK),开发者可以通过Github链接下载https://github.com/facebook/facebook-sdk-swift。目前这一SDK基于Swift2,不过Facebook称他们将很快推出Swift3 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:06 | 阅读:118 | 回复:0
  • 【ios学习】Swift 4.2新特性
    【ios学习】Swift 4.2新特性
    Swift 4.2是Swift 4的第二次小更新,随之带来了很多很棒的改进-这使得今年将成为Swift的重要一年,并且更加确认这个社区驱动的Swift演变进程正在让一个伟大的语言变得更好。 这次我们获得了一些特性比如enum case 数 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:06 | 阅读:98 | 回复:0
  • [Swift]LeetCode21.合并两个有序链表|MergeTwoSortedLists
    [Swift]LeetCode21.合并两个有序链表|MergeTwoSortedLists
    ★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★➤微信公众号:山青咏芝(shanqingyongzhi)➤博客园地址:山青咏芝(https://www.cnblogs.com/strengthen/)➤GitHub地址:http 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:06 | 阅读:107 | 回复:0
  • Swift搭建本地http服务器,实现外部视频即时播放
    Swift搭建本地http服务器,实现外部视频即时播放
    最近项目有个小需求,需要ios实现手机作为服务端,将内部视频文件,在外面能够直接访问 结合网上的例子,实现如下: 1、基于CocoaHTTPServer实现 2、可用pod集成,也可直接拖动文件集成 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:06 | 阅读:102 | 回复:0
  • swift:创建滚动视图的图片轮播器
    swift:创建滚动视图的图片轮播器
    用swift创建图片轮播器和用OC创建的方式是一样的,都主要用到UIScrollView和UIImageview这两个控件,有几张图片,就将滚动视图的内容区域大小设置为每一张图片的大小乘以张数即可。然后允许实现分页功能pagingEnable 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:06 | 阅读:96 | 回复:0
  • OC、Swift判断相机、相册、麦克风、定位的权限
    OC、Swift判断相机、相册、麦克风、定位的权限
    最近关于隐私比较关注有个需求:判断相机、相册、麦克风、定位的权限是否打开。点击没设置过权限,就弹窗申请权限,设置过,再设置就跳转App设置这里就把OC和Swift的相关代码分享一下,节省读者时间!//是否开启麦克 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:06 | 阅读:88 | 回复:0
  • [Swift]关键字:class与staitc的区别
    [Swift]关键字:class与staitc的区别
    ★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★➤微信公众号:山青咏芝(shanqingyongzhi)➤博客园地址:山青咏芝(www.zengqiang.org)➤GitHub地址:https://github.com/str 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:06 | 阅读:92 | 回复:0
  • 苹果新的编程语言Swift语言进阶(十四)--扩展
    苹果新的编程语言Swift语言进阶(十四)--扩展
        扩展是为一个已经存在的类、结构、枚举类型加入新功能的一种方式。包含为不能存取源码的那些已经存在的类型加入功能。    扩展相似于Objective-C语言中的类别,与类别不同的是Swift语言的扩展没有名字。 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:05 | 阅读:105 | 回复:0
  • 苹果Swift编程语言入门教程【中文版】
    苹果Swift编程语言入门教程【中文版】
    目录 1 简介 2 Swift入门 3 简单值 4 控制流 5 函数与闭包 6 对象与类 7 枚举与结构 1 简介 Swift是供iOS和OS X应用编程的新编程语言,基于C和Objective-C,……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:05 | 阅读:120 | 回复:0
  • iOS多线程简介-Swift版本3.多线程开发--RunLoop
    iOS多线程简介-Swift版本3.多线程开发--RunLoop
    前面,我们讲完了NSOperation的使用,现在让我们来看看在iOS中得一些多线程开发的注意事项.1.RunLoop在iOS中,它有一种运行机制,叫做RunLoop,让我们来看看什么是RunLoop1.RunLoop提供了⼀种异步执⾏代码的机制,不能并⾏ 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:05 | 阅读:122 | 回复:0
  • 21个高质量的Swift开源iOS App
    21个高质量的Swift开源iOS App
    原文:21 Amazing Open Source iOS Apps Written in Swift 对Swift初学者来说,学习开源项目,阅读源码是个不错的方法。在这篇文章中,基于对代码质量和排名……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:05 | 阅读:145 | 回复:0
  • [Swift]美人征婚问题
    [Swift]美人征婚问题
    ★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★➤微信公众号:为敢(WeiGanTechnologies)➤博客园地址:山青咏芝(https://www.cnblogs 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:05 | 阅读:131 | 回复:0
  • Swift统计操作list container、show account结果为0的问题
    Swift统计操作list container、show account结果为0的问题
    在学习新的东西时,常常会遇到一些问题,然后当时不得其解,想着记录下来,之后再深入理解,但总是会忘掉。所以,对!本文就是个坑!留着填! 问题描述: 使用swift API,在具有一定数量的object、container的账号下 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:05 | 阅读:131 | 回复:0
  • [Swift]LeetCode72.编辑距离|EditDistance
    [Swift]LeetCode72.编辑距离|EditDistance
    ★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★➤微信公众号:山青咏芝(shanqingyongzhi)➤博客园地址:山青咏芝(https://www.cnblogs.com/strengthen/)➤GitHub地址:http 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:05 | 阅读:111 | 回复:0
  • Swift基本数据类型与运算符表达式
    Swift基本数据类型与运算符表达式
    ////main.swift//LessonSwift01////Createdbylanouhnon16/1/25.//Copyright©2016年齐彦坤.Allrightsreserved.//importFoundation//输出函数print(amp;quot;Hello,World!amp;quot;)//单行注释//……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:04 | 阅读:112 | 回复:0
  • Swift5.4语言指南(八)函数
    Swift5.4语言指南(八)函数
    ★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★➤微信公众号:山青咏芝(shanqingyongzhi)➤博客园地址:山青咏芝(https://www.cnblogs.com/strengthen/)➤GitHub地址:http 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:04 | 阅读:108 | 回复:0
  • [Swift]LeetCode454.四数相加II|4SumII
    [Swift]LeetCode454.四数相加II|4SumII
    ★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★➤微信公众号:山青咏芝(shanqingyongzhi)➤博客园地址:山青咏芝(https://www.cnblogs.com/strengthen/)➤GitHub地址:http 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:04 | 阅读:99 | 回复:0
  • swift画图Charts的基本使用
    swift画图Charts的基本使用
     下面的这些代码呢是在oc工程里里使用的其实和在swift中使用没什么大的差别属性都一样的//创建饼状图   self.pieChartView=initWithFrame:CGRectMake(20,80,f_Device_w-40,300)];    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:04 | 阅读:113 | 回复:0
  • [Swift]LeetCode448.找到所有数组中消失的数字|FindAllNumbersDisappearedinanArray ...
    [Swift]LeetCode448.找到所有数组中消失的数字|FindAllNumbersDisappearedinanArray ...
    ★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★➤微信公众号:山青咏芝(shanqingyongzhi)➤博客园地址:山青咏芝(https://www.cnblogs.com/strengthen/)➤GitHub地址:http 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:04 | 阅读:93 | 回复:0
  • Swift弹窗
    Swift弹窗
    在一个ViewController中使用以下代码: let alertController = UIAlertController(title: amp;quot;Game Setamp;quot;, message: amp;quot;You got 100amp;quot;, preferredStyle: .Alert) alertController.addActio 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:04 | 阅读:113 | 回复:0
  • Swift-使用CATransition制作过渡动画(页面切换转场效果)
    Swift-使用CATransition制作过渡动画(页面切换转场效果)
    CATransition动画主要在过渡时使用,比如两个页面层级改变的时候添加一个转场效果。CATransition分为两类,一类是公开的动画效果,一类是非公开的动画效果。1,公开动画效果:kCATransitionFade:翻页kCATransitionM 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:04 | 阅读:111 | 回复:0
  • 窥探Swift系列博客说明及其Swift版本间更新
    窥探Swift系列博客说明及其Swift版本间更新
    Swift到目前为止仍在更新,每次更新都会推陈出新,一些Swift旧版本中的东西在新Swift中并不适用,而且新版本的Swift会添加新的功能。到目前为止,Swift为2.1版本。去年翻译的Swift书籍是1.0版本,所以上面一些东西并 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:03 | 阅读:137 | 回复:0
  • swift2.x学习笔记(二)
    swift2.x学习笔记(二)
    p.p1{margin:0;font:14pxMenlo;color:rgba(0,132,0,1)}p.p2{margin:0;font:14pxMenlo;min-height:16px}p.p3{margin:0;font:14pxMenlo}p.p4{margin:0;font:14pxMenlo;color:r……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:03 | 阅读:130 | 回复:0
  • swift实践-04--UIButton
    swift实践-04--UIButton
    importUIKit classViewController:UIViewController{   //按钮的创建  //UIButtonType.system:前面不带图标,默认文字为蓝色,有触摸时的高亮效果  //UIButtonType.custom:定制按钮,前面不带图标,默认文字为白 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:03 | 阅读:146 | 回复:0
  • [Swift]LeetCode210.课程表II|CourseScheduleII
    [Swift]LeetCode210.课程表II|CourseScheduleII
    ★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★➤微信公众号:山青咏芝(shanqingyongzhi)➤博客园地址:山青咏芝(https://www.cnblogs.com/strengthen/)➤GitHub地址:http 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:03 | 阅读:121 | 回复:0
  • Swift3 substring几种常用用法
    Swift3 substring几种常用用法
    举例: 这边的第三种方法不是最优的,系统其实有提供一个Range方法 如图: 实现如下: 其中,end中的6 = 4+2,表示结束位置。 Enjoy~……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:03 | 阅读:118 | 回复:0
  • Swift扩展(Extension)总结
    Swift扩展(Extension)总结
    扩展是给已经存在的类(class),结构体(structure),枚举类型(enumeration)和协议(protocol)增加新的功能。类似Objective-C中的Category,不同的是,Extension没有名字。扩展可以做以下事情:增加计算实例属 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:03 | 阅读:115 | 回复:0
  • [Swift实际操作]七、常见概念-(4)范围CGRect的使用详解
    [Swift实际操作]七、常见概念-(4)范围CGRect的使用详解
    热烈欢迎,请直接点击!!!进入博主AppStore主页,下载使用各个作品!!!注:博主将坚持每月上线一个新app!!!本文将为你演示区域对象CGRect的使用。你可以将区域对象,看作是点对象和尺寸对象的组合首先导入需 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:02 | 阅读:184 | 回复:0
  • swift代理使用
    swift代理使用
    代理声明://oc调用代理@objc(NurseListCellDelegate)protocolNurseListCellDelegate:NSObjectProtocol{funcnurseListCellDidClickedDeleteNurseAction(nurseListCell:NurseListCell)funcnurseListCellD……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:02 | 阅读:176 | 回复:0
  • 7函数——《Swift3.0从入门到出家
    7函数——《Swift3.0从入门到出家
    6函数函数就是对某个功能的封装,一个swift程序可能由多个函数组成swift中定义函数的格式:func函数名称(参数列表)—amp;amp;gt;函数返回值类型{函数体return } 函数定义要素:func是定义函数的关键字函数名名字 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:02 | 阅读:190 | 回复:0
  • swift对象存储安装
    swift对象存储安装
    对象存储服务概览 OpenStack对象存储是一个多租户的对象存储系统,它支持大规模扩展,可以以低成本来管理大型的非结构化数据,通过RESTful HTTP 应用程序接口。 它包含下列组件: 代理服务 ...……
    作者:菜鸟教程小白 | 时间:2022-7-13 12:02 | 阅读:172 | 回复:0
热门推荐
专题导读
热门话题
阅读排行榜

扫描微信二维码

查看手机版网站

随时了解更新最新资讯

139-2527-9053

在线客服(服务时间 9:00~18:00)

在线QQ客服
地址:深圳市南山区西丽大学城创智工业园
电邮:jeky_zhao#qq.com
移动电话:139-2527-9053

Powered by 互联科技 X3.4© 2001-2213 极客世界.|Sitemap